Buying label makers supplies often comes down to a fork in the road: do you need to print labels from scratch, or do you just need to put existing labels onto containers perfectly? The DuraLabel Toro Label Maker Printer and The Label Wizard Adjustable Applicator sit on opposite sides of that fork. This head-to-head looks at what each really offers, so you can pick the one that matches your labeling volume and budget.

Quick verdict

If your work involves printing labels on demand in a busy environment, the DuraLabel Toro is the complete setup. If you already have labels and need them applied straight, evenly, and bubble-free, The Label Wizard Adjustable is the tool you'll want.

DuraLabel Toro

The built-in keyboard lets you type and print labels without needing a separate computer. The unit comes with ribbon supplies that are described as new in wrapper, so you can start labeling equipment, documents, or products right away. It's part of the DuraLabel Toro series, which focuses on reliable and efficient office equipment for business and industrial settings. The included ribbons and keyboard make it a nearly ready-to-run package. The trade-off is the $850 price, a substantial investment compared with a manual applicator. If your labeling needs are occasional or low-volume, this printer might offer more power than you actually use.

The Label Wizard Adjustable

This manual applicator is for when you have labels ready to go. The sliding platform locks in place with a star knob, and the squeegee bar presses labels down without bubbles. It also includes an engraved ruler scale for positioning, and non-slip rubber feet for stability on the workbench. It's built from Baltic birch plywood and designed for candle makers, soap makers, home brewers, and small-batch sellers who need labels on bottles, jars, and containers of varying widths. The limitation is that it can't print labels; you'll need to source labels separately or print them yourself. It's a specialized tool that focuses purely on the application step, and it does that step well.
